    I'm always looking to shop local and especially at mom and pop shops and I'm so glad this one is in…read moremy neighborhood. They have an astonishing selection of craft as well as the standards at a reasonable price (remember it's not a big box so they don't have the same bargaining power based on volume). The wine selection is good and the liquor, considering it's a smallish space, is better than you would expect. Good variety on basics like vodka, tequila and rum and not bad on whiskey. They have more single malt scotch choices than most places in town and a big plus is, when I asked if they would consider offering my go-to, the 12 year-old Singleton, they stocked it for me (best value for a Speyside pretty much anywhere but especially here. Try it if you haven't - you can thank me later ). Nice folks. Helpful. If there's no parking right in front, there is plenty at the park directly across the street. Just yards away. They have sodas and snacks and most of the convenience store stuff you need.
